Message type: E = Error
Message class: L5 - LVS multiple processing
Message number: 207
Message text: No change in determination of 2-step procedure for group &

- No change in determination of 2-step procedure for group & ?The SAP error message L5207, which states "No change in determination of 2-step procedure for group &," typically occurs in the context of inventory management and logistics, particularly when dealing with the two-step stock transfer process. This error indicates that there is no change in the determination of the two-step procedure for the specified group, which can be related to configuration or master data issues.
Causes:
Configuration Issues: The two-step procedure may not be properly configured in the system. This could involve settings related to stock transport orders, movement types, or the configuration of the relevant plant or storage location.
Master Data Issues: The material master data or the configuration of the relevant material group may not support the two-step procedure. This could include missing or incorrect settings in the material master or the relevant purchasing or sales organization.
Inconsistent Data: There may be inconsistencies in the data related to the stock transport order or the materials involved in the transfer.
User Authorization: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the operation, leading to the error.
Solutions:
Check Configuration: Review the configuration settings for the two-step stock transfer process in the SAP system. Ensure that the relevant movement types, stock transport order settings, and other related configurations are correctly set up.
Review Master Data: Check the material master data for the materials involved in the transfer. Ensure that the relevant fields are correctly populated and that the materials are set up to allow for two-step procedures.
Data Consistency: Verify the consistency of the data related to the stock transport order. Check for any discrepancies or missing information that could be causing the error.
User Authorization: Ensure that the user attempting to perform the operation has the necessary authorizations. If not, work with your SAP security team to grant the required permissions.
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idance on the two-step procedure and any related configuration settings.
SAP Notes: Check for any relevant SAP Notes that may address this specific error message or provide additional troubleshooting steps.
